Flood Warning issued June 5 at 9:09AM CDT until June 9 at 2:12PM CDT by NWS Kansas City/Pleasant Hill MO ...The Flood Warning is extended for the following rivers in Missouri... Platte River near Agency affecting Buchanan County. * WHAT...Minor flooding is occurring and moderate flooding is forecast. * WHERE...Platte River near Agency. * WHEN...Until early Tuesday afternoon. * IMPACTS...At 20.0 feet, Low-lying areas east of Agency begin to flood. At 25.0 feet, Flooding begins at the east border of Agency. At 30.0 feet, Many farm levees along the river are overtopped and nearly all rural roads are under water.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 8:30 AM CDT Friday the stage was 22.9 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to rise to a crest of 29.1 feet just after midnight tonight. It will then fall below flood stage early Monday afternoon. - Flood stage is 20.0 feet.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ood Motorists should not attempt to drive around barricades or drive cars through flooded areas.
